Incremental Backup Versus Differential Backup on Cloud Storage

On Cloud Storage Like OpenStack Swift, We Can Set Different Backup Strategy on Our Need. Differential backup is a backup of all changes made since the last full backup which is good for quicker recovery. Incremental Backups are last full backup plus incremental changes as backups. How To Set Up rsnapshot For Backup Of WordPress on Cloud Server/VPS

rsnapshot Once Set, Can Automatically Incrementally Backup. rsnapshot is a Free Software intended to use on CLI for server backups. It is essentially a filesystem snapshot utility based on more older tool rsync. rsync takes snapshots of local and remote filesystems, and rotates the snapshots according to your settings.
